One happy return in Kings Mountain

Chad Baily, seven, returned to West Elementary School in Kings Mountain pushing a walker after a blood vessel burst in his head last January left him nearly dead. Teachers describe his comeback as a miracle as he walks in with support from his legs.

Running for President Takes on New Meaning

Washington AP describes Georgia lawmakers seeking face time with President Clinton during jogs on Air Force One and around the White House. Rep. Buddy Darden lobbies to jog with the president and later recalls an hour-long walk and Oval Office coffee. The piece notes political value in Clinton’s daily jogs for lawmakers and the rise of such requests.

Pizza deliveryman fired after flashing rifle during robbery

Hutchinson Kansas AP A Pizza Hut driver was fired for flashing an assault rifle to stop a robbers. Dale Tipton 34 filed a grievance seeking reinstatement. Pizza Hut says drivers may not carry weapons and should cooperate with robbers. Police said the rifle was unloaded and Tipton did nothing illegal.

Russians Feel Loss After Breakup Of Soviet Union

Two years after the 1991 coup, Russians express regret over the Soviet breakup and flag a stagnant or worsened life. The Center for Public Opinion found 62 percent lament the dissolution, with only 24 percent glad, while inflation soars and unemployment climbs as Yeltsin reshapes the economy.

July 1993 Sets Extreme Temperature and Rainfall Records

A nationwide July showed stark contrasts with record highs and lows, and extreme rainfall in the Midwest. The West North Central region saw its wettest July, while the Southwest was the driest. Southeast warmth topped 82.7 F as Northwest cooled to 58.9 F.
